The Personal Privacy Conversation You Can Not Miss

Prior to you hurry to apply every AI tool you can discover, pump the brakes. HIPAA compliance continues to be important, and specialists should choose AI tools that include solid personal privacy safeguards mirroring legal requirements.

The warnings are easier to find than you might believe. Devices that store information on non-secure web servers. Systems without certain medical care conformity. Free tools that monetize your information (due to the fact that if you're not paying for the product, you are the item) Services without clear personal privacy policies. AI systems that educate on your client information to boost their formulas.

Select systems constructed particularly for healthcare providers, not general-purpose AI chatbots that could be feeding your session notes right into their next training dataset. The ease isn't worth losing your permit over.

The Framework No One Sees

Your portable method needs unnoticeable framework-- the dull things that makes whatever else possible. Cloud-based EHR systems that allow you accessibility client documents securely from anywhere. HIPAA-compliant video platforms that aren't Zoom or FaceTime yet healthcare-specific solutions created for the regulative scrutiny we encounter. Trustworthy VPN solutions that safeguard information even on questionable resort Wi-Fi. Back-up net services like mobile hotspots for redundancy. Encrypted cloud storage for papers that need added protection. Technique management software program that handles scheduling, invoicing, and customer interactions while you're literally beyond of the globe.

The preliminary investment really feels considerable-- someplace in between 2 and four thousand bucks for equipment and regular monthly registrations that total perhaps 2 hundred bucks. But compare that to typical workplace overhead, and the math obtains interesting quick.

When Innovation Falls Short (And It Will)

The web will drop during a session. At some point, undoubtedly, it will certainly take place. Possibly during a crucial advancement moment. Maybe when a client remains in crisis. Maybe when you're in a foreign country with unknown infrastructure.

And you'll manage it with a procedure, just like you would certainly manage any kind of disruption. You keep the client's contact number conveniently accessible. You call quickly if the connection goes down. You use your backup internet to reconnect by means of video clip. You proceed using phone if video clip won't maintain. You reschedule if needed, without charging for cut off time. You do not stress, due to the fact that panic isn't helpful and you're a specialist that prepares for contingencies.

Customers understand innovation fails. What they can not accept is a therapist who worries or does not have a strategy. The innovation failure isn't the trouble-- your reaction is what matters.

The Moral Measurement Nobody Intends To Discuss

Technology and liberty are exciting, yet they come with obligations that aren't optional accessories-- they're core needs.

Educated approval should clearly attend to exactly how AI is made use of in treatment. Customers are worthy of transparency concerning what's being automated and what continues to be simply human judgment. They need to comprehend what data is saved where and what safeguards protect their privacy. Unclear reassurances aren't sufficient-- details, straightforward disclosure is called for.

Data security ends up being exponentially more complicated when you're working from numerous areas. Beyond HIPAA-compliant platforms, you need encrypted data storage, safe and secure password administration systems, and mindful interest to physical safety when working from public or semi-public rooms. The ease of functioning from a coffee shop has to be stabilized versus the responsibility of securing customer discretion. That balance is achievable, however it calls for aware interest instead of hope.

Social skills takes on brand-new dimensions when your customer base spans geographical areas. Remote technique typically suggests offering customers from varied backgrounds and areas. This increased reach requires recurring education and learning regarding the details neighborhoods you serve and level of sensitivity to exactly how cultural factors affect mental health and treatment choices. The assumption that your training covered "social competence" sufficiently comes to be obviously not enough when you're seeing clients from contexts you've never ever directly experienced.
